Abstract

本发明涉及包装保护技术领域,且公开了一种延展性好的耐挤压保护膜,包括黏胶层,所述黏胶层涂设在下压层的下表面,且所述下压层的上表面固定连接有聚丙烯树脂层,所述聚丙烯树脂层的上表面固定连接有连接柱,所述连接柱的顶部插接入凹槽内,所述凹槽开设在上压层的下表面,且所述连接柱下部的外部活动连接有TPE带,所述上压层的上表面设置有气囊层,所述气囊层的顶部活动连接有共聚聚丙烯层,所述上压层通过连接层与气囊层活动连接。该延展性较好的耐挤压保护膜,通过设置连接柱与TPE带,利用连接柱的固定性和TPE带的韧性,能够较大的提升整个保护膜的抗拉伸能力,并且在受到挤压时可以将挤压的力进行较好的缓冲。

一种延展性好的耐挤压保护膜
技术领域
本发明涉及包装保护技术领域,具体为一种延展性好的耐挤压保护膜。
背景技术
保护膜按照用途可以分为数码产品保护膜,汽车保护膜,家用保护膜,食品保鲜保护膜等。其中一些保护膜被人们放在金属表面,在金属进行冲压以后再撕去保护膜,从而起到保护金属表面的作用,用来确保金属的尺寸,另一些保护膜则用来作为物体与物体之间的缓冲结构,防止物体的表面受到损伤。
目前使用的金属表面保护膜以及缓冲保护膜普遍采取了加厚的方法来增大保护膜的耐挤压能力,但是这种方法会增加生产成本,并且因为保护膜材料的特殊性,一般为一次性用品,过厚的材质会增加生产成本,并且造成环境的污染,并且在厚度增加到一定程度以后保护膜所能起到的坑挤压能力就几乎停止了增长,导致抗挤压能力也不强。
发明内容
(一)解决的技术问题
针对现有技术的不足,本发明提供了一种延展性好的耐挤压保护膜,具备耐挤压且 延展性较好的优点,解决了目前金属保护膜以及缓冲保护膜抗挤压能力不强,且延展性无 法满足人们需求的问题。
(二)技术方案
为实现上述延展性较好的耐挤压保护膜耐挤压且延展性较好目的,本发明提供如下技 术方案:一种延展性好的耐挤压保护膜,包括黏胶层,所述黏胶层涂设在下压层的下表 面,且所述下压层的上表面固定连接有聚丙烯树脂层,所述聚丙烯树脂层的上表面固定连 接有连接柱,所述连接柱的顶部插接入凹槽内,所述凹槽开设在上压层的下表面,且所述连 接柱下部的外部活动连接有TPE带,所述上压层的上表面设置有气囊层,所述气囊层的顶部 活动连接有共聚聚丙烯层,所述上压层通过连接层与气囊层活动连接。
优选的,所述共聚聚丙烯层的下表面固定连接有拉伸网,所述拉伸网的厚度低于气囊层厚度的一半。
优选的,所述拉伸网的网孔为矩形。
优选的,所述连接柱与TPE带组成网孔为菱形的网状结构。
优选的,所述连接柱与TPE带组成的菱形相邻两边较大的夹角为一百二十度。
(三)有益效果
与现有技术相比,本发明提供了一种延展性好的耐挤压保护膜,具备以下有益效果:
1、该延展性较好的耐挤压保护膜,通过设置连接柱与TPE带,利用连接柱的固定性和 TPE带的韧性,能够较大的提升整个保护膜的抗拉伸能力,并且在受到挤压时可以将挤压的 力进行较好的缓冲。
2、该延展性较好的耐挤压保护膜,通过设置气囊层和拉伸网,提高了整个保护膜的抗挤压能力,从而起到较好的保护作用。

请参阅图1-3,一种延展性好的耐挤压保护膜,包括黏胶层1,黏胶层1涂设在下 压层2的下表面,下压层2的上表面固定连接有聚丙烯树脂层3,聚丙烯树脂层3的上表面固 定连接有连接柱4,连接柱4的顶部插接入凹槽5内,凹槽5开设在上压层6的下表面,连接柱4下部的外部活动连接有TPE带7,上压层6的上表面设置有气囊层8,气囊层8的顶部活动连接有共聚聚丙烯层9,上压层6通过连接层11与气囊层8活动连接。
共聚聚丙烯层9的下表面固定连接有拉伸网10,拉伸网10的厚度低于气囊层厚度8的一半。
拉伸网10的网孔为矩形。
连接柱4与TPE带7组成网孔为菱形的网状结构。
连接柱4与TPE带7组成的菱形相邻两边较大的夹角为一百二十度。
保护膜设置在金属的表面时,有时是需要保护膜保护金属的表面,因为有时金属加工对于尺寸和精度要求较高,如果采取直接冲压的方法金属之间势必会产生一定的磨损,当加工者对于金属的尺寸精度要求较高时就无法满足加工者的需求,因此需要添加保护膜,一般的保护膜就是单一的一层膜,这种保护膜无法较好的吸收金属之间作用产生的缓冲力,并且还容易破裂起不到相应的保护作用,本发明首先添加了黏胶层1可以加强保护膜与金属之间的连接,并且黏胶层1的连接方式可以使得外力能够均匀的分布在保护膜的表面,如果采取螺钉等结构则会产生力道集中,使得保护膜受力不均容易破碎,同时设置了下压层2与上压层6可以较好的吸收外力,进行缓冲,并且设置的连接柱4和TPE带7形成的了菱形可以满足各种方向的外力的拉扯,提高了整个装置的延展性,并且连接柱4的底部是固定连接的,连接柱4的顶部插接在凹槽5内,可以稍微活动,从而加强了延展性,拉伸网10则可以加强共聚聚丙烯层9的坚韧性,综上所述,本发明具有较好的延展性和抗拉伸性,从而能够满足使用者的需求。
综上所述,该延展性较好的耐挤压保护膜,通过设置连接柱4与TPE带7,利用连接柱4的固定性和TPE带7的韧性,能够较大的提升整个保护膜的抗拉伸能力,并且在受到挤压时可以将挤压的力进行较好的缓冲,通过设置气囊层8和拉伸网10,提高了整个保护膜的抗挤压能力,从而起到较好的保护作用。
